Question 394114: A baseball team played 141 complete games last season. They had 13 fewer wins than losses. How many games did the team win?
x = games won
13 + x = 141
x = 128
I am completely lost! Am I even on the right track.

okay so what you need to do for a kind of guess and check solution would be to divide 141 by 2.
141/2=70.5
so lets say that they won 70 and lost 71 so then you need to figure out how you can have 13 fewer wins than losses.
so
70 and 71 difference of 1
69 and 72 difference of 3
68 and 73 difference of 5
67 and 74 difference of 7
66 and 75 difference of 9
65 and 76 difference of 11
64 and 77 difference of 13
so that would mean that they won 64 games and lost 77 games.
77-64=13
